Ordinals
beta
Sat 1324278366936655
decimal
319711.866936655
degree
0°109711′1183″866936655‴
percentile
63.06087468539818%
name
elvqdklqfkc
cycle
0
epoch
1
period
158
block
319711
offset
866936655
timestamp
2014-09-08 13:40:45 UTC
rarity
common
prev
next